Justin Bieber has one less lonely girl -- oops, sorry, we didn't mean to break into song and quote his lyrics. He has one less legal drama to worry about, as he has gotten off scott free in the $9 million lawsuit that the mother of a Belieber levied at him over her hearing loss.

The woman, Stacey Betts, filed a lawsuit against the singer last summer, claiming she took her daughter to see the Biebs in 2010. The singer got the crowd so riled up that the incessant, high decibel shrieking of thousands of teenaged girls caused her to have permanent hearing damage.

Betts was seeking a whopping $9 million in damages, but TMZ reports that it was she who actually filed documents asking that the case be dismissed since she doesn't have a lawyer and can't afford to pursue any more legal action.

Betts insists that dropping the case has nothing to do with her injuries or the merits of her claims. Those are legit; she just can't pay for the legal proceedings. Mmm hmm.
